• 报错:Exception: org.apache.sqoop.common.SqoopException Message: DRIVER_0002:Given job is already running


    报错背景:

    创建完成job之后,执行job的时候报错。

    报错现象:

    Exception: org.apache.sqoop.common.SqoopException Message: CLIENT_0001:Server has returned exception
    Stack trace:
         at  org.apache.sqoop.client.request.ResourceRequest (ResourceRequest.java:129)  
         at  org.apache.sqoop.client.request.ResourceRequest (ResourceRequest.java:179)  
         at  org.apache.sqoop.client.request.JobResourceRequest (JobResourceRequest.java:112)  
         at  org.apache.sqoop.client.request.SqoopResourceRequests (SqoopResourceRequests.java:154)  
         at  org.apache.sqoop.client.SqoopClient (SqoopClient.java:481)  
         at  org.apache.sqoop.shell.StartJobFunction (StartJobFunction.java:75)  
         at  org.apache.sqoop.shell.SqoopFunction (SqoopFunction.java:51)  
         at  org.apache.sqoop.shell.SqoopCommand (SqoopCommand.java:127)  
         at  org.apache.sqoop.shell.SqoopCommand (SqoopCommand.java:103)  
         at  org.codehaus.groovy.tools.shell.Command$execute (null:-1)  
         at  org.codehaus.groovy.runtime.callsite.CallSiteArray (CallSiteArray.java:42)  
         at  org.codehaus.groovy.tools.shell.Command$execute (null:-1)  
         at  org.codehaus.groovy.tools.shell.Shell (Shell.groovy:101)  
         at  org.codehaus.groovy.tools.shell.Groovysh (Groovysh.groovy:-1)  
         at  sun.reflect.NativeMethodAccessorImpl (NativeMethodAccessorImpl.java:-2)  
         at  sun.reflect.NativeMethodAccessorImpl (NativeMethodAccessorImpl.java:62)  
         at  sun.reflect.DelegatingMethodAccessorImpl (DelegatingMethodAccessorImpl.java:43)  
         at  java.lang.reflect.Method (Method.java:498)  
         at  org.codehaus.groovy.reflection.CachedMethod (CachedMethod.java:90)  
         at  groovy.lang.MetaMethod (MetaMethod.java:233)  
         at  groovy.lang.MetaClassImpl (MetaClassImpl.java:1054)  
         at  org.codehaus.groovy.runtime.ScriptBytecodeAdapter (ScriptBytecodeAdapter.java:128)  
         at  org.codehaus.groovy.tools.shell.Groovysh (Groovysh.groovy:173)  
         at  sun.reflect.NativeMethodAccessorImpl (NativeMethodAccessorImpl.java:-2)  
         at  sun.reflect.NativeMethodAccessorImpl (NativeMethodAccessorImpl.java:62)  
         at  sun.reflect.DelegatingMethodAccessorImpl (DelegatingMethodAccessorImpl.java:43)  
         at  java.lang.reflect.Method (Method.java:498)  
         at  org.codehaus.groovy.runtime.callsite.PogoMetaMethodSite$PogoCachedMethodSiteNoUnwrapNoCoerce (PogoMetaMethodSite.java:267)  
         at  org.codehaus.groovy.runtime.callsite.PogoMetaMethodSite (PogoMetaMethodSite.java:52)  
         at  org.codehaus.groovy.runtime.callsite.AbstractCallSite (AbstractCallSite.java:141)  
         at  org.codehaus.groovy.tools.shell.Groovysh (Groovysh.groovy:121)  
         at  org.codehaus.groovy.tools.shell.Shell (Shell.groovy:114)  
         at  org.codehaus.groovy.tools.shell.Shell$leftShift$0 (null:-1)  
         at  org.codehaus.groovy.tools.shell.ShellRunner (ShellRunner.groovy:88)  
         at  org.codehaus.groovy.tools.shell.InteractiveShellRunner (InteractiveShellRunner.groovy:-1)  
         at  sun.reflect.NativeMethodAccessorImpl (NativeMethodAccessorImpl.java:-2)  
         at  sun.reflect.NativeMethodAccessorImpl (NativeMethodAccessorImpl.java:62)  
         at  sun.reflect.DelegatingMethodAccessorImpl (DelegatingMethodAccessorImpl.java:43)  
         at  java.lang.reflect.Method (Method.java:498)  
         at  org.codehaus.groovy.reflection.CachedMethod (CachedMethod.java:90)  
         at  groovy.lang.MetaMethod (MetaMethod.java:233)  
         at  groovy.lang.MetaClassImpl (MetaClassImpl.java:1054)  
         at  org.codehaus.groovy.runtime.ScriptBytecodeAdapter (ScriptBytecodeAdapter.java:128)  
         at  org.codehaus.groovy.runtime.ScriptBytecodeAdapter (ScriptBytecodeAdapter.java:148)  
         at  org.codehaus.groovy.tools.shell.InteractiveShellRunner (InteractiveShellRunner.groovy:100)  
         at  sun.reflect.NativeMethodAccessorImpl (NativeMethodAccessorImpl.java:-2)  
         at  sun.reflect.NativeMethodAccessorImpl (NativeMethodAccessorImpl.java:62)  
         at  sun.reflect.DelegatingMethodAccessorImpl (DelegatingMethodAccessorImpl.java:43)  
         at  java.lang.reflect.Method (Method.java:498)  
         at  org.codehaus.groovy.runtime.callsite.PogoMetaMethodSite$PogoCachedMethodSiteNoUnwrapNoCoerce (PogoMetaMethodSite.java:267)  
         at  org.codehaus.groovy.runtime.callsite.PogoMetaMethodSite (PogoMetaMethodSite.java:52)  
         at  org.codehaus.groovy.runtime.callsite.AbstractCallSite (AbstractCallSite.java:137)  
         at  org.codehaus.groovy.tools.shell.ShellRunner (ShellRunner.groovy:57)  
         at  org.codehaus.groovy.tools.shell.InteractiveShellRunner (InteractiveShellRunner.groovy:-1)  
         at  sun.reflect.NativeMethodAccessorImpl (NativeMethodAccessorImpl.java:-2)  
         at  sun.reflect.NativeMethodAccessorImpl (NativeMethodAccessorImpl.java:62)  
         at  sun.reflect.DelegatingMethodAccessorImpl (DelegatingMethodAccessorImpl.java:43)  
         at  java.lang.reflect.Method (Method.java:498)  
         at  org.codehaus.groovy.reflection.CachedMethod (CachedMethod.java:90)  
         at  groovy.lang.MetaMethod (MetaMethod.java:233)  
         at  groovy.lang.MetaClassImpl (MetaClassImpl.java:1054)  
         at  org.codehaus.groovy.runtime.ScriptBytecodeAdapter (ScriptBytecodeAdapter.java:128)  
         at  org.codehaus.groovy.runtime.ScriptBytecodeAdapter (ScriptBytecodeAdapter.java:148)  
         at  org.codehaus.groovy.tools.shell.InteractiveShellRunner (InteractiveShellRunner.groovy:66)  
         at  java_lang_Runnable$run (null:-1)  
         at  org.codehaus.groovy.runtime.callsite.CallSiteArray (CallSiteArray.java:42)  
         at  org.codehaus.groovy.runtime.callsite.AbstractCallSite (AbstractCallSite.java:108)  
         at  org.codehaus.groovy.runtime.callsite.AbstractCallSite (AbstractCallSite.java:112)  
         at  org.codehaus.groovy.tools.shell.Groovysh (Groovysh.groovy:463)  
         at  org.codehaus.groovy.tools.shell.Groovysh (Groovysh.groovy:402)  
         at  org.apache.sqoop.shell.SqoopShell (SqoopShell.java:128)  
    Caused by: Exception: org.apache.sqoop.common.SqoopException Message: DRIVER_0002:Given job is already running - Job with id 1
    Stack trace:
         at  org.apache.sqoop.driver.JobManager (JobManager.java:285)  
         at  org.apache.sqoop.handler.JobRequestHandler (JobRequestHandler.java:380)  
         at  org.apache.sqoop.handler.JobRequestHandler (JobRequestHandler.java:116)  
         at  org.apache.sqoop.server.v1.JobServlet (JobServlet.java:96)  
         at  org.apache.sqoop.server.SqoopProtocolServlet (SqoopProtocolServlet.java:79)  
         at  javax.servlet.http.HttpServlet (HttpServlet.java:646)  
         at  javax.servlet.http.HttpServlet (HttpServlet.java:723)  
         at  org.apache.catalina.core.ApplicationFilterChain (ApplicationFilterChain.java:290)  
         at  org.apache.catalina.core.ApplicationFilterChain (ApplicationFilterChain.java:206)  
         at  org.apache.hadoop.security.authentication.server.AuthenticationFilter (AuthenticationFilter.java:631)  
         at  org.apache.hadoop.security.token.delegation.web.DelegationTokenAuthenticationFilter (DelegationTokenAuthenticationFilter.java:301)  
         at  org.apache.hadoop.security.authentication.server.AuthenticationFilter (AuthenticationFilter.java:579)  
         at  org.apache.catalina.core.ApplicationFilterChain (ApplicationFilterChain.java:235)  
         at  org.apache.catalina.core.ApplicationFilterChain (ApplicationFilterChain.java:206)  
         at  org.apache.catalina.core.StandardWrapperValve (StandardWrapperValve.java:233)  
         at  org.apache.catalina.core.StandardContextValve (StandardContextValve.java:191)  
         at  org.apache.catalina.core.StandardHostValve (StandardHostValve.java:127)  
         at  org.apache.catalina.valves.ErrorReportValve (ErrorReportValve.java:103)  
         at  org.apache.catalina.core.StandardEngineValve (StandardEngineValve.java:109)  
         at  org.apache.catalina.connector.CoyoteAdapter (CoyoteAdapter.java:293)  
         at  org.apache.coyote.http11.Http11Processor (Http11Processor.java:859)  
         at  org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ler (Http11Protocol.java:610)  
         at  org.apache.tomcat.util.net.JIoEndpoint$Worker (JIoEndpoint.java:503)  
         at  java.lang.Thread (Thread.java:748)  
    sqoop:000> 

    报错原因:

    日志中的提示信息说明,此时已经有一个job正在运行,所以报错。

    报错解决:

    查看这个job的状态:sqoop:000> status job --jid 1

    结束这个job的进程:sqoop:000> stop job --jid 1

    再次重新启动job: sqoop:000> start job --jid 1

    不再报错。

  • 相关阅读:
    单例模式 MonoState
    适配器模式+AutoFac
    复合模式 泛型检查
    复合模式
    OpenDaylight实验
    Open vSwitch
    Mininet入门实战
    Python基础语句学习
    修改用户密码登录期限
    springboot maven自定义jar包包名, 增加环境、时间版本号信息
  • 原文地址:https://www.cnblogs.com/chuijingjing/p/10856722.html
Copyright © 2020-2023  润新知